Saved from becoming a footnote in history by Ian Macleod Distillers in 2024, the painstaking process of restoring and reopening the distillery is approaching. Soon Rosebank’s unique combination of worm tub condensers and triple distillation will once again be used to create whisky. Rosebank: A spirit reawakened. early years programme of study
